Outcasts Word Wizard

TermDefinition
squadron an operational unit in an air force consisting of two or more flights of aircraft and the personnel required to fly them
diplomat an official representing a country abroad
intramural taking place within a single educational institution
conservative holding to traditional attitudes and values and cautious about change or innovation, typically in relation to politics or religion
sentiment a view of or attitude toward a situation or event; an opinion
gravelly resembling, containing, or consisting of gravel
sentimental weakly emotional; mawkishly susceptible or tender
groaning a low, mournful sound uttered in pain or grief
commotion a condition of civil unrest or insurrection
vigorously strong; active
abide to remain; continue
unanimously without opposition; with the agreement of all people involved
scuffling engage in a short, confused fight or struggle at close quarters
menacing a person or thing that is likely to cause harm
ensued happen or occur afterward or as a result
tattered old and torn; in poor condition
ransacked go hurriedly through stealing things and causing damage
converged when several people or things come together from different directions so as eventually meet
invigorated give strength or energy to.
unassertive (of a person) not having or showing a confident and forceful personality
subsidized support (an organization or activity financially
hauled (of a person) pull or drag with effort or force
amiss not quite right; inappropriate or out of place
coaxed persuade (someone) gradually or by flattery to do something
